Eight teams confirmed for Super 8 stage
Kingston | March 26, 2007 8:15:05 AM IST
 

 

 

Bangladesh with their seven-wicket win over Bermuda in the last Group B match of the World Cup Sunday became the eighth team to qualify for the Super Eight stage starting Tuesday.

Defending champions Australia and world No. 1 South Africa have progressed to Super Eight from Group A, Sri Lanka from Group B, New Zealand from Group C, and the West Indies and minnows Ireland from Group D.

England was the second team to qualify from Group C, and they did it Saturday by beating Kenya by seven wickets.

Bangladesh's win over Bermuda also knocked out 1983 winners India out of the World Cup.
